Find the side and perimeter of a square whose diagonal is 10 cm.

उत्तर

Let ABCD be the given square.
AC = 10 cm
Let the side of the square be x cm.
∴ AB = BC = x cm
In Δ ABC,
∠ABC = 90° ...(Angle of a square)
∴ by Pythagoras theorem,
AC2 = AB2 + BC2
∴ 102 = x2 + x2
∴ 100 = 2x2
∴ x2 = `100/2`
∴ x2 = 50
∴ x = `5sqrt2`
∴ AB = `5sqrt2` cm
∴ side of a square is `5sqrt2` cm.
Perimeter of a square = 4 × side
= 4 × `5sqrt2`
= `20sqrt2` cm
∴ Side of a square is `5sqrt2` cm and its perimeter is `20sqrt2` cm.
